mjaleo, the reason your plist looks different from the one you are trying to make it look like is because the text is too wide for the terminal window you are editing in and the editor has appended a $ to indicate that there is more to the line that you can't see. if you make the terminal window wider, you will see the rest of the line and it will probably look just like the one in the example except for red part which was the edit. you can actually just copy that red text right out of this thread and paste it into your plist.

What do I change here, and I'm not understanding HOW I change it... What is the keystroke for changing it? We're a bit over my head ;)

 

Run terminal

 

Enter "sudo -s" (without quotes)

 

Enter your password when asked.

 

Enter "cd /System/Library/Extensions/AppleVIAATA.kext/Contents" (without quotes)

 

Enter "nano Info.plist" (without quotes - nano is the terminal based text editor, aka pico)

 

Search (Ctrl+w) for "IOPCI" (without quotes)

 

On the following line insert 0x05711106 at the front of the list of numbers.

 

Press Ctrl+X to exit & save.

 

Enter "diskutil repairpermissions /" (without quotes)

 

Reboot and if you're lucky it'll work.

 

I installed jas 10.4.9 uphuck 1.2.. but I cannot make my ethernet work! I have iofamilynetwork.kext but I cannot find appleyukon.kext.. (I have a gigabyte ds3). what can I do??

 

 

The Yukon kext is inside the IOFamily kext.

 

To get to it:

 

cd /System/Library/Extensions/IONetworkingFamily.kext/Contents/PlugIns/AppleYukon.kext/Contents

 

Then edit the Info.plist in that directory to change the numbers.

how hard is it to update from 4.8 to 4.9 (and 4.10 in the future)?

 

No new problem. The same procedure as from 10.4.6 to 10.4.8.

I install MacOSXUpd10.4.9Intel.dmg and replace {mach_kernel, AppleSMBIOS.kext, IOATAFamily.kext, loginwindow.app} That's all for working system. Video works with natit.kext same as for 10.4.8.

Moreover there is new feature "rotate display" appear after the update. Sound disappeared but easily restored from the same ALC883.mpkg (6 ports). All are works!
